What is a 45ft Container?
A 45ft container, also called a high cube container, is a standard shipping container that determines 45 feet in length, 8 feet in width, and 9 feet 6 inches in height. This size uses a considerable advantage over the more typical 20ft and 40ft containers, providing more volume for cargo while maintaining the basic dimensions that fit most ships, trucks, and trains. The 45ft container is especially useful for bulk shipments, machinery, and other big products that need extra area.

Elements Influencing 45ft Container Prices
Worldwide Supply and Demand
- Supply Chain Disruptions: Events such as the COVID-19 pandemic, port blockage, and geopolitical stress can cause provide chain disturbances, impacting the schedule and cost of 45ft container storage containers.
- Economic Conditions: Economic growth or economic downturn in significant markets can influence the need for shipping containers, thereby impacting rates.
Manufacturing Costs
- Raw Materials: The cost of steel, which is the primary material utilized in container manufacturing, can vary due to changes in worldwide steel rates.
- Labor Costs: The cost of labor in making nations, such as China, can also affect the total production cost of containers.
Freight Rates
- Ocean Freight: The cost of ocean freight, that includes bunker fuel costs and shipping company rates, plays a considerable role in the general cost of carrying 45ft containers.
- Land and Air Freight: For inland transport, the cost of trucking and rail services can also impact the final price of the d container size.
Regulative and Environmental Factors
- Laws: Changes in worldwide shipping guidelines, such as those related to safety and environmental requirements, can increase the cost of compliance for shipping business.
- Ecological Initiatives: Efforts to decrease carbon emissions and promote sustainable practices can result in extra costs for shipping business, which may be handed down to consumers.
Market Competition
- Container Leasing Companies: The competition among container leasing companies can influence the availability and rates of 45ft containers. A higher supply of containers can result in lower costs, while a scarcity can drive costs up.
- Shipping Companies: The competitors among shipping companies can likewise impact costs, as they might use discount rates or premium services to bring in consumers.

Frequently Asked Questions About 45ft Container Prices
What is the typical cost of a 45ft container?
- The cost of a 45ft container can vary significantly depending upon elements such as place, market conditions, and the type of container (new or utilized). On average, a new 45ft container can cost in between ₤ 5,000 and ₤ 10,000, while a used container may be readily available for between ₤ 2,000 and ₤ 5,000.
How do I identify the very best price for a 45ft container?
- To determine the very best price, it is recommended to compare quotes from multiple suppliers, think about the condition of the container, and factor in extra costs such as transport and handling. Negotiating with providers and leveraging long-lasting contracts can also help protect better prices.
Are 45ft containers more pricey than 40ft containers?
- Typically, 45ft containers are more expensive than 40ft containers due to their larger size and increased capacity. Nevertheless, the cost difference might be balanced out by the performance gains and lowered dealing with costs connected with utilizing a bigger container.
What are the primary elements that affect the price of a 45ft container?
- The main aspects affecting the price of a 45ft container consist of worldwide supply and need, manufacturing expenses, freight rates, regulatory and ecological factors, and market competitors.
How can I minimize the cost of shipping a 45ft container?
- To decrease the cost of shipping a 45ft container, consider enhancing your cargo to maximize making use of area, working out with shipping business for better rates, and checking out alternative transportation paths. In addition, combining deliveries with other business can help in reducing expenses.
